السلام عليكم و رحمة الله و بركاته
اخواني الاعزاء / برمجت مركز رفع بسيط جدا و يتكون من التالي
up.php الفورم
up2.php و هو لرفع الملف للسيرفر SERVER و عرض النتيجة و هذه محتوياتهم
رمز PHP:
<code style="white-space:nowrap"> <code> up.php
<form enctype="multipart/form-data" action="up.php" method="POST">
<input type="hidden" name="MAX_FILE_SIZE" value="100000" />
<p> </p>
<table border="0" width="100%" cellspacing="0" cellpadding="0">
<tr>
<td>
<p align="center"> <input name="uploadedfile" type="file" /></td>
<td> </td>
</tr>
</table>
<p align="center"> <br />
<input type="submit" value="ارفع الملف" /> </p>
</form>
</code> </code>
up2.php
رمز PHP:
<code style="white-space:nowrap"> <code>
$target_path = "up/";
$target_path = $target_path . basename( $_FILES['uploadedfile']['name']
;
if(move_uploaded_file($_FILES['uploadedfile']['tmp_name'], $target_path)) {
echo "تم رفع الملف بنجاح ". basename( $_FILES['uploadedfile']['name']
.
" بنجاح";
} else{
echo "هنالك خلل , لم يتم رفع الملف بصورة صحيحة";
}
</code> </code>
طبعا كمل ما ترون فانه يمكن لاي شخص ان يرفع شل و يخترق الموقع

جربت العديد من الاكواد التي تحدد الامتدادات و حجم الملفات و لم تنفع
و حاولت عمل الاكواد الموجودة في موضوع phpman و لم اعرف طريقة دمجها مع الكود code السابق
ارجوا منكم التكرم و شرح طريقة اضافة اي اكواد للحماية او شرح طريقة اضافة الاكواد المتواجدة في الموضوع الخاص بـ phpman على الرابط التالي من
هنا
و اشكركم مقدماّ